Default a/c problems

I am having trouble with the a/c system in my 2002 silverado. the electrical harness has been highly modified and in the process I accidentally removed the high pressure recirculation switch signal wires from the c2 connector on the under hood fuse panel. The computer has also been re programmed for a 2002 camaro. I dont know why but the dyno tuner said it was a better base for programming my engine. I was told that my computer will no longer interface with the 2002 silverado high pressure recirculation switch. Is there any truth to this? If so is there a way to bypass the computer to get the a/c compressor to turn on? I am a little lost in my research because I don't know exactly what the computer does with the pressure switches.
